Output 468f5f0c76aa3312f5dd2e6d88c3033667f4b2a7a17daf5dacc6c0476127a687:0

value
16164598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d59150d13a8ee023b76ae691f5786787c41107d6 OP_EQUAL
address
3MAFw7cysPBMyZGhrit9TVAKe6aoipGh2S
transaction
468f5f0c76aa3312f5dd2e6d88c3033667f4b2a7a17daf5dacc6c0476127a687
confirmations
99054
spent
true